PROBLEM SYMPTOMS TABLE [04/2013 - ]

HINT

  1. Use the table below to help determine the cause of problem symptoms. If multiple suspected areas are listed, the potential causes of the symptoms are listed in order of probability in the "Suspected Area" column of the table. Check each symptom by checking the suspected areas in the order they are listed. Replace parts as necessary.
  2. Inspect the fuses and relays related to the system before inspecting the suspected areas below.
  3. If the problem occurs in certain locations or times of day, the possibility of wave interference is high.
  4. If a malfunction occurred after optional components were installed at the dealer, check if there is wave interference from the components.

DIAGNOSIS SYSTEM [04/2013 - ]

  1. DESCRIPTION Smart access system with push-button start (for Start Function) data and Diagnostic Trouble Codes (DTCs) can be read through the Data Link Connector 3 (DLC3) of the vehicle. When the system seems to be malfunctioning, use the Techstream to check for malfunctions and perform repairs.
  2. CHECK DLC3 Check the DLC3. Refer to «GENERAL INFORMATION [04/2013 - ]»(ref-665529-S26412111322014102400000)
  3. INSPECT BATTERY VOLTAGE Measure the battery voltage. Standard Voltage 11 to 14 V If the voltage is below 11 V, recharge or replace the battery.

DTC CHECK / CLEAR [04/2013 - ]

Note. When using the Techstream with the engine switch off, connect the Techstream to the DLC3 and turn a courtesy light switch on and off at intervals of 1.5 seconds or less until communication between the Techstream and the vehicle begins. Then select the vehicle type under manual mode and enter the following menus: Body Electrical / Smart Access. While using the Techstream, periodically turn a courtesy light switch on and off at intervals of 1.5 seconds or less to maintain communication between the Techstream and the vehicle.

  1. CHECK FOR DTC (CERTIFICATION ECU (SMART KEY ECU ASSEMBLY) (POWER SOURCE CONTROL)) Connect the Techstream to the DLC3. Turn the engine switch on (IG). Turn the Techstream on. Enter the following menus: Body Electrical / Power Source Control / Trouble Codes. Body Electrical > Power Source Control > Trouble Codes Check for DTCs.
  2. CHECK FOR DTC (CERTIFICATION ECU (SMART KEY ECU ASSEMBLY) (SMART ACCESS)) Connect the Techstream to the DLC3. Turn the engine switch on (IG). Turn the Techstream on. Enter the following menus: Body Electrical / Smart Access / Trouble Codes. Body Electrical > Smart Access > Trouble Codes Check for DTCs.
  3. CHECK FOR DTC (CERTIFICATION ECU (SMART KEY ECU ASSEMBLY) (STARTING CONTROL)) Connect the Techstream to the DLC3. Turn the engine switch on (IG). Turn the Techstream on. Enter the following menus: Body Electrical / Starting Control / Trouble Codes. Body Electrical > Starting Control > Trouble Codes Check for DTCs.
  4. CLEAR DTC (CERTIFICATION ECU (SMART KEY ECU ASSEMBLY) (POWER SOURCE CONTROL)) Connect the Techstream to the DLC3. Turn the engine switch on (IG). Turn the Techstream on. Enter the following menus: Body Electrical / Power Source Control / Trouble Codes. Body Electrical > Power Source Control > Clear DTCs Clear the DTCs by following the directions on the Techstream display.
  5. CLEAR DTC (CERTIFICATION ECU (SMART KEY ECU ASSEMBLY) (SMART ACCESS)) Connect the Techstream to the DLC3. Turn the engine switch on (IG). Turn the Techstream on. Enter the following menus: Body Electrical / Smart Access / Trouble Codes. Body Electrical > Smart Access > Clear DTCs Clear the DTCs by following the directions on the Techstream display.
  6. CLEAR DTC (CERTIFICATION ECU (SMART KEY ECU ASSEMBLY) (STARTING CONTROL)) Connect the Techstream to the DLC3. Turn the engine switch on (IG). Turn the Techstream on. Enter the following menus: Body Electrical / Starting Control / Trouble Codes. Body Electrical > Starting Control > Clear DTCs Clear the DTCs by following the directions on the Techstream display.

  1. DATA LIST HINT: Using the Techstream to read the Data List allows the values or states of switches, sensors, actuators and other items to be read without removing any parts. This non-intrusive inspection can be very useful because intermittent conditions or signals may be discovered before parts or wiring is disturbed. Reading the Data List information early in troubleshooting is one way to save diagnostic time. NOTE: In the table below, the values listed under "Normal Condition" are reference values. Do not depend solely on these reference values when deciding whether a part is faulty or not. Connect the Techstream to the DLC3. Turn the engine switch on (IG). Turn the Techstream on. Enter the following menus: Body Electrical / (desired system) / Data List. Read the Data List according to the display on the Techstream. Body Electrical > Power Source Control > Data List Tester Display Measurement Item Range Normal Condition Diagnostic Note Shift P Signal Shift position P OFF or ON OFF: Shift lever not in P ON: Shift lever in P Use this item to determine whether the shift lever position switch (P) is malfunctioning. Steering Unlock Switch State of steering unlock sensor signal output from steering lock ECU (steering lock actuator assembly) OFF or ON OFF: Steering locked ON: Steering unlocked When the shift lever is in P and the engine switch is off, if any door is opened or closed, the steering is locked. When the electrical key transmitter sub-assembly is in the cabin and the engine switch is turned on (ACC) or on (IG), the steering unlocks. The engine cannot be started when the steering unlock signal is off. Stop Light Switch1 State of brake pedal OFF or ON OFF: Brake pedal released ON: Brake pedal depressed Use this item to determine whether the stop light switch is malfunctioning. The engine cannot be started when this item is OFF. If the stop light switch is malfunctioning, the engine can be started by pressing and holding the engine switch for a certain period of time. Start Switch1 Engine switch 1 status OFF or ON OFF: Engine switch not pressed ON: Engine switch pressed If the engine switch is pressed for a short time, the display may not change. Use this item to determine whether the engine switch input signal is malfunctioning. Start Switch2 Engine switch 2 status OFF or ON OFF: Engine switch not pressed ON: Engine switch pressed Backup for engine switch 1. However, when the engine switch is pressed and held, the control functions only when both engine switch 1 and 2 are normal. Behaves the same way as engine switch 1. Neutral SW/ Clutch SW Shift position (P and N) OFF or ON OFF: Shift lever in any position other than P or N ON: Shift lever in P or N Use this item to determine whether the park/neutral start switch assembly is malfunctioning. When the engine cannot be started due to a park/neutral start switch assembly malfunction, OFF is displayed. Latch Circuit Status of IG related backup circuits OFF or ON OFF: Engine switch off ON: Engine switch on (IG) Displays in almost the same manner as the IG relay. When the engine switch is on (ACC), OFF is displayed. Starter Request Signal Engine start request signal status OFF or ON OFF: After approx. 1 second has elapsed, the engine switch is released ON: With the shift lever in P and the brake pedal depressed, the engine switch is pressed and held When the engine cannot be started due to a start request signal malfunction, OFF is displayed. When the engine switch is pressed, the duration of time that ON is displayed will be extremely short. As such, the engine switch needs to be pressed and held for a certain period of time. ACC Relay Monitor ACC relay activation OFF or ON OFF: Engine switch off ON: Engine switch on (ACC) When the engine switch is on (IG), ON is displayed. While the engine is cranking, OFF is displayed. Body Electrical > Smart Access > Data List Tester Display Measurement Item Range Normal Condition Diagnostic Note Key Low Battery Transmitter battery depleted No or Yes No: Transmitter battery not depleted Yes: Transmitter battery depleted The electrical key transmitter sub-assembly sends voltage information to the certification ECU (smart key ECU assembly) when it is transmitting. The certification ECU (smart key ECU assembly) displays "Yes" for the "Key Low Battery" item of the Data List when this voltage information indicates 2.2 V or less. This Data List item should be checked when the electrical key transmitter sub-assembly is at room temperature (example: at -20°C (-4°F), "Yes" may be displayed even if the transmitter battery is new). # Codes Number of DTCs 0 to 255 - - Immobilizer Immobilizer system status determined by certification ECU (smart key ECU assembly) Set or Unset Set: Immobilizer set (engine start prohibited) (engine switch off) Unset: Immobilizer unset (engine start permitted) (engine switch on (ACC) or on (IG)) The engine cannot be started when Set is displayed. HINT: The security indicator light blinks when Set is displayed. The security indicator light is linked with set/unset of the immobilizer and not linked with lock/unlock of the steering. Steering Lock Sleep Cond Steering lock ECU sleep availability No or Yes No: Sleep not available Yes: Sleep available - Steering Lock Start Cond Steering lock ECU wake up signal status No or Yes No: Wake up signal not sent Yes: Wake up signal sent - Engine Start Condition Status of engine start permission signal determined by steering lock ECU (steering lock actuator assembly) and sent to certification ECU (smart key ECU assembly) NG or OK NG: Engine start prohibited OK: Engine start permitted When OK is displayed, the certification ECU (smart key ECU assembly) receives an unlock confirmation signal from the steering lock ECU (steering lock actuator assembly) and makes fuel injection and engine starting possible. The engine cannot be started when NG is displayed. Sensor Value History of malfunction of position sensor in steering lock ECU (steering lock actuator assembly) (DTC B2781 is stored) OK or NG(Past) OK: History of malfunction for the lock or unlock sensor in the steering lock ECU (steering lock actuator assembly) does not exist. NG(Past): History of both the lock and unlock sensors in the steering lock ECU (steering lock actuator assembly) being on exists. (Under normal operation, neither sensor is on.) When NG(Past) is displayed, either the position sensor in the steering lock ECU (steering lock actuator assembly) or the assembly itself may be malfunctioning.   2. ACTIVE TEST HINT: Using the Techstream to perform Active Tests allows relays, VSVs, actuators and other items to be operated without removing any parts. This non-intrusive functional inspection can be very useful because intermittent operation may be discovered before parts or wiring is disturbed. Performing Active Tests early in troubleshooting is one way to save diagnostic time. Data List information can be displayed while performing Active Tests. Connect the Techstream to the DLC3. Turn the engine switch on (IG). Turn the Techstream on. Enter the following menus: Body Electrical / (desired system) / Active Test. Perform Active Test according to the display on the Techstream.
